Tianzifang refers to a cluster of alleyways right off Taikang Road in the former French Concession populated with more than 200 little cafes, restaurants, small craft stores and souvenir shops. You'll find all kinds of knick knacks here, from trendy artworks to Mao posters to clothing and hand-painted ceramics. It's a popular tourist destination in Shanghai, so beware that there is haggling in your future if you want decent prices, but either way you'll enjoy wandering around, taking in the shikumen architecture, stopping for a coffee or bubble tea and heading back through the maze. Tell taxi drivers you want to enter Tianzifang at Taikang Road Lane 210 or 248.
